From James Madison to Albert Gallatin, 10 July 1808
Dept. of State, July 10th. 1808.
Sir.
I have the honor to request that you cause a warrant to be issued in favor of William Lewis, lately charged with Dispatches to Europe, for one hundred and Seventy nine dollars & ninety two cents, to be paid out of the foreign intercourse fund. The said Lewis to be charged accordingly on the Books of the Treasury. I am &c.
James Madison
